1. vibration damping; seismic damping
A construction technology that reduces a building's shaking during an earthquake by installing dampers that absorb seismic energy. Distinguished from 耐震(たいしん) (making the structure strong enough to resist quakes) and 免震(めんしん) (isolating the building from ground motion).

Similar words

  • 耐震(たいしん): earthquake resistance — making the structure itself strong enough to withstand shaking
  • 免震(めんしん): base isolation — separating the building from ground motion with isolators
